Joan Tomlin Obituary

Joan "Jo" Marie Tomlin

August 7, 1943 - March 10, 2025

Joan "Jo" Marie Tomlin passed away peacefully under hospice care on March 10, 2025 in Scottsdale, Arizona. Jo was born on August 7, 1943 in David City, Nebraska to Harry and Anna Reisdorff. She was one of 5 siblings who grew up on a farm acquired by The Homestead Act of 1862. This family farm is still one of the oldest farms in Nebraska today that has been continuously held by one family since its inception. She met her husband Cordell "Corkey" Tomlin in Omaha, Nebraska in 1968. They were married in Chicago, Illinois, where they lived for 1 year before moving to Fountain Hills, Arizona in 1972, where they had two daughters Cristi and Kari. The family moved back and forth between Colorado and Arizona their entire lives pursuing farming and real estate development, but Jo always considered Arizona her home. A music teacher and pianist, Jo was always involved in sharing her love for music, either in the classroom or in attending musicals, plays, and performances with her loved ones. She made sure her daughters had the important life skills to cook, sew, and play music, but she also encouraged them to think deeply and pursue their passions. She had a great eye for beauty, and she loved shopping at antique stores, farm auctions, and art fairs for the jewelry and art that filled her home. Jo is preceded in death by her parents Harry and Anna Reisdorff and her sister Nancy Scullion. She is survived by her husband Corkey, her daughters Cristi Lewis and Kari King, her sister Janie Harding, her brothers Jim Reisdorff and John Reisdorff, and her 5 grandchildren. She will be deeply missed.
